Features & Benefits
- Recommended by inverter manufacturers for optimal performance.
- High-speed response to short circuits ensures your safety.
- Complies with ABYC/USCG standards for reliability.
- Supports systems up to 160 Volts DC.
- Designed for large wire sizes up to 4/0 AWG.
- Constructed with heat-dissipating tin-plated copper for durability.
